Abstract
Remembering Holly Springs is a series of photographs that explore the efforts of community education programs that engage with the remembrance of enslaved peoples and future of land stewardship in Holly Springs, Mississippi. In our current moment, traditional institutions like museums and universities have been the target of political censorship and historical revisionism, causing a sense of urgency around the future of remembrance practices and protecting the truth about the dependence on slave labor in building the nation and undergirding its economic success. The aim of this thesis is to shed light on alternative forms of knowledge creation through place-based learning and provide a snapshot of a few of the folks that make it possible.
